import java.util.ArrayList;
import java.util.List;
public class test {
public static void main(String[] args) {
//需要判断的list
List list1 = new ArrayList();
list1.add(1);
list1.add(2);
list1.add(2);
list1.add(1);
list1.add(4);
//去重后的list
List list2 = new ArrayList();
for(int i=0;i<list1.size();i++){
//判断
if(!list2.contains(list1.get(i))){
list2.add(list1.get(i));
}else{
System.out.println("重复的元素为:"+list1.get(i)+"。在list中的下标"+i);
}
}
//System.out.println(list1.size());
//System.out.println(list2.size());
}
}